The Algorithmic Curriculum: Exploring the Role of Big Data in Course Design
In this rapidly evolving educational landscape, institutions are increasingly turning to big data to transform course design. The burgeoning field known as the algorithmic curriculum explores the potential of big data analytics to tailor learning experiences and boost student outcomes.
By gathering vast amounts of student performance data, systems can pinpoint patterns of learning behavior, anticipating areas where students may face challenges. These insights may be used to develop more relevant curricula, providing customized learning pathways that address the specific needs of each student.
- Furthermore, algorithmic curriculum design can streamline logistical tasks, providing space for educators to focus on mentorship.
- Despite these potential benefits, there are also philosophical considerations that need to be addressed carefully.
For example, concerns regarding data privacy, algorithm bias, and the potential of dependency on technology must be thoroughly considered. As a result, the successful implementation of algorithmic curriculum design requires a holistic approach that values both innovation and ethical practices.
